At the age of 61, James F. Kerr passed away peacefully in a hospital in Orlando, FL, on September 18, 2018.James was one of five children of the late Teresa and Francis Kerr. He was also predeceased by his daughter, Nicole in 2003; and his three sisters, Terri (Toy), Bernie (Cherry), and Maureen (Orr).A Delaware native, Jay, "Smoove," brought joy and comfort to countless people throughout his life. He had a heart bigger than any other. He was a graduate of Christiana High School, and while working part-time at Crowell, he also enjoyed working at the Playhouse Theater with "Brownie" as part of the lighting crew for many years. He transitioned into railroad work, spending many years at Amtrak as a car repairman. He loved his Harley and the freedom of riding with friends. He was very involved with AA and ran the New Year's Eve parties at Clayton Hall years ago.He is survived by his son, Joel (Brianna Mahon) and their children, Nova and Luke, who gave Jay great joy; his brother, Patrick, who lives in New York; and his ex-wife, Linda Kotalik, who has been one of his biggest supporters. James has many aunts, uncles, nieces, nephews, and cousins who will feel a great loss without him.Friends and family are invited to a visitation from 11 A.M. to 12 P.M. with funeral services beginning at 12 P.M. at the Mealey Funeral Home, 2509 Limestone Road Wilmington, DE 19808, on Saturday, October 13th.
